Question:
When is it necessary to break the nose during a rhinoplasty surgery?
Answer:
There are several indications for performing osteotomies in rhinoplasty. The most common are either pre-existing deviation of the nasal bones where straightening is indicated or when a bump is taken down in which case the nasal bones need to be brought together again. Either way it is not a big deal at all to perform osteotomies and the outcome with them is often better than not performing them. The recovery is essentially the same.
